TIP What is “serial poll” ?
• The controller which receives an SRQ (Service Request) will call the talkers that it
assumes are transmission sources. When the addressed talker transmits a status
byte (8-bit data) back to the controller to represent the talker condition, the control-
ler will check each byte to identify the source talker.
When the controller calls a talker for this purpose, it sends an SPE (Serial Poll
Enable) to the talker to discriminate from general addressing to the talker.
